There will be no flights at Resunga Airport for the entire month of February. A small plane of Nepal Airlines was taking flight at the airport.
According to Suman Thapa, head of the airline's Resunga office, the flight has been suspended due to a problem with the plane that was being loaded to take off the flight. There are two small planes in Nepal Airlines.
'One ship has already been damaged and the rest of the other ship also had a problem with its engine. The ship is currently damaged and is in Kathmandu for repair,'' he said, 'there is no possibility of flying even throughout February,' Chief Thapa said that it took more time to make it by bringing materials from abroad.
The last time the airline operated a Tamghas-Kathmandu flight at Resunga Airport on 24th of December 2081. The airport, which had its first flight on May 3, 2079, has had only 90 flights in nearly 20 months.
According to station in-charge Thapa, 1,165 Tamghas-Kathmandu and 1,088 Kathmandu-Tamghas passengers were served in that flight. The ship can carry up to 19 passengers at a time. Although there are flights at the airport, there are only three employees.
